Party Drinks

Drink recipe from fireside:

1 can limeade frozen concentrate
2 - 2 liter 7-up
1/2 c. sugar
1 T almond extract
1 T vinegar
Lemon slices and ice cubes to float on top.

You can substitute different concentrates (or additional ones on top of a basic one), add mashed bananas, or berries to come up with a variety of party drink concotions.

If you want it to be slush, just freeze for 24 hours before serving w/o the 7-up and add it prior to party.

The secret to the zing is the vinegar and almond extract for the extra flavor. I thought of trying rum extract, that might be tasty, too.

And this Dorito Taco salad. I'm sure you all have this recipe, but I thought I'd share anyway.
1 pound ground beef or turkey
3/4 head of lettuce 
3 tomatoes
Doritos (you can use baked if you want)
1 can kidney beans (we like black better) drained and rinsed
a little onion
1 cup grated cheddar cheese
3/4 bottle Thousand Island dressing (you can use light or Fat Free)

Chop and mix tomatoes, lettuce, and cheese.  Mix with dressing.  Brown hamburger, drain, and add the beans. Simmer for 10 min. Add to salad.  Serve with crushed Doritos.  I like it topped with sour cream and avocados.
